(Vocal Collection). For well over a century, the G. Schirmer edition of
24 Italian Songs & Arias of the 17th and 18th Centuries has
introduced millions of beginning singers to serious Italian vocal
literature. Offered in two accessible keys suitable for all singers, it
is likely to be the first publication a voice teacher will ask a
first-time student to purchase. The classic Parisotti realizations
result in rich, satisfying accompaniments which allow singers pure
musical enjoyment. For ease of practice, carefully prepared
accompaniments are also recorded on CD by John Keene, a New York-based
concert accompanist and vocal coach who has performed throughout the
United States for radio and television. Educated at the University of
Southern California, Keene has taught accompanying at the university
level and collaborated with Gian Carlo Menotti and Thea Musgrave on
productions of their operas.
